1956 Chrysler Imperial vs. 2009 Mazda 6

To start off, 2009 Mazda 6 is newer by 53 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1956 Chrysler Imperial.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1956 Chrysler Imperial would be higher. At 5,423 cc (8 cylinders), 1956 Chrysler Imperial is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2009 Mazda 6 (272 HP @ 6250 RPM) has 25 more horse power than 1956 Chrysler Imperial. (247 HP @ 4600 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2009 Mazda 6 should accelerate faster than 1956 Chrysler Imperial.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1956 Chrysler Imperial weights approximately 1275 kg more than 2009 Mazda 6.

Let's talk about torque, 1956 Chrysler Imperial (470 Nm @ 2800 RPM) has 105 more torque (in Nm) than 2009 Mazda 6. (365 Nm @ 4250 RPM). This means 1956 Chrysler Imperial will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2009 Mazda 6.
